WebMar 14, 2024 · Normal pumping output with full time nursing is .5-2 ounces combined. Normal output in place of nursing is 2-4 ounces combined. You are doing just fine, momma! Most ebf babies top out at 3-4 ounces per feeding or 1-1.5 ounces per hour away from mom. WebThis can be for two reasons: Because colostrum is very concentrated and your baby doesn’t need much of it, your breasts don’t produce very much. Colostrum is very thick and seems to be more difficult to pump. Is it normal to only get 1 oz when I pump? It can be frustrating when you spend a half hour pumping just to get a couple ounces. WebIf yes, it is pretty normal to only get a little milk while pumping, because your baby is already removing milk from your breast. In fact, the amount that you get from pumping is extra milk (read once again: extra milk, meaning …
